Output 0dd38375ece57bb24f543aade12f16603f61176dfec1c73c593a17b5df6ec9ad:4

value
3778369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1857b1b897b03620d6756c3af54b3067a8578d89 OP_EQUALVERIFY OP_CHECKSIG
address
13DiGhupcenT7zB1FtEebTufp9eSqGha8i
transaction
0dd38375ece57bb24f543aade12f16603f61176dfec1c73c593a17b5df6ec9ad
spent
true